2个回答
展开全部
Linux可以安装ASP支持扩展,chili ASP和iASP这两个就是在Linux安装的ASP扩展,但我建议你不要试了,安装起来不是一般的麻烦,而是超级麻烦,要先搭建JAVA环境,如JDK、Servlet等等,而且你就算把环境按步就班搭建起来,但在使用过程中也有很多ASP代码无法执行,搞起来真是吃力不讨好喔。
下载相关软件
mod_perl-1.27.tar 下载:http://perl.apache.org/download/index.html
下载mod_perl压缩包,要下载mod_perl 2.0,因为我用的是APACHE2.X的,如果是apache1.X的就下载mod_perl1.0
解包,执行:
perl Makefile.PL MP_APXS=/usr/local/apache/bin/apxs
make
make test
make install
然后在httpd.conf中追加一行
LoadModule perl_module modul?es/mod_perl.so
然后看一下,是否支持mod_perl
随便敲入一个不存在的网址,会列出,看是否有mod_perl
也可以
telnet localhost 80
输入get Head /http /1.0
看看是否有mod_perl
安装Apache::ASP
perl -MCPAN -e shell
cpan> install CPAN
cpan> install MLDBM
cpan> install MLDBM::Sync
cpan> install Apache::ASP
在httpd.conf文件中追加上:
PerlModule Apache::ASP
<Fil?es ~ (\.asp)>
SetHandler perl-script
PerlHandler Apache::ASP
PerlSetVar Global .
PerlSetVar StateDir /tmp/asp
</Fil?es>
建一个asp文件,测试一下吧~
下载相关软件
mod_perl-1.27.tar 下载:http://perl.apache.org/download/index.html
下载mod_perl压缩包,要下载mod_perl 2.0,因为我用的是APACHE2.X的,如果是apache1.X的就下载mod_perl1.0
解包,执行:
perl Makefile.PL MP_APXS=/usr/local/apache/bin/apxs
make
make test
make install
然后在httpd.conf中追加一行
LoadModule perl_module modul?es/mod_perl.so
然后看一下,是否支持mod_perl
随便敲入一个不存在的网址,会列出,看是否有mod_perl
也可以
telnet localhost 80
输入get Head /http /1.0
看看是否有mod_perl
安装Apache::ASP
perl -MCPAN -e shell
cpan> install CPAN
cpan> install MLDBM
cpan> install MLDBM::Sync
cpan> install Apache::ASP
在httpd.conf文件中追加上:
PerlModule Apache::ASP
<Fil?es ~ (\.asp)>
SetHandler perl-script
PerlHandler Apache::ASP
PerlSetVar Global .
PerlSetVar StateDir /tmp/asp
</Fil?es>
建一个asp文件,测试一下吧~
推荐于2017-11-22
展开全部
安装apache及相应的模块可以勉强支持asp(不全面,比如你或许不能使用微软的数据库,com等,这样的话,请问asp还有什么用)所以在linux下最为常用组合 apache+mysql+php+tomcat+jsp。学习linux基本命令,推荐《linux就该这么学》!
本回答被提问者采纳
已赞过
已踩过<
评论
收起
你对这个回答的评价是?
推荐律师服务:
若未解决您的问题,请您详细描述您的问题,通过百度律临进行免费专业咨询